### Changed defaults

This release tightens several security-relevant defaults. Suppression-list entries are now permanent rather than expiring after ninety days, webhook signatures are verified strictly (previously log-only), and the processor refuses unauthenticated relay connections outright. Retry ceilings were lowered to reduce amplification risk if an upstream is compromised. Reviewers should confirm downstream consumers tolerate the stricter signature checks. The new defaults shipped in this release are listed below.

deployment values, yadug-bawif:
[framir]
team = pelox
access_code = ac_a38ab2
owner = tamion.julael
host = framir.tolvaqlabs.test
port = 11211
peer = tammir.zemvargrid.local
salt = 2215ef03
pin = 1541

## Deploying the Gatewick Proctor Queue

Deploys are pretty painless: push to main, wait for the pipeline, then watch the queue drain dashboard for five minutes. If candidates pile up mid-exam, roll back first and ask questions later — the queue replays safely. Everything the workers care about lives in one config block, shown here for reference.

settings of bafof-yagef:
JOROX_PIN=8740
JOROX_TENANT=pelox
JOROX_METRICS_HOST=metrics.jorox.qorvelworks.internal
JOROX_SEAL=seal_c78f63c1
JOROX_STANDBY_TEAM=norax

Q4 Planning Note — Sales Leads

Quick heads up: the sale of our Bramblewick Services unit to Oakhurst Partners is moving ahead, likely closing mid-quarter. Keep Bramblewick accounts steady and don't promise renewals past March. Territory reshuffles land after close. More colour on what happens next is in the confidential note below.

board note of kageg-bahof: The renewal with Holwynax Holdings closes at $2 million a year, 5 percent below the last contract. Project Ulaath slips by two quarters because of the supplier delay.